hi
i have a leak on a bottom entry designer radiator ive tried ptfe tape and had a few goes but we are still leaking has anyone got any cures thanks
 
putting a lot of ptfe tape on tried once with a couple of wraps and got
leaks so took back apart and wraped twenty or so rounds and still getting leaks and yess wrapping round so the ptfe tape nips in not threads out
 
If you put too much on it pushes back out. I used to use 6 or 7 wraps then a smear of jointing paste. I now use 6 turns of loctite 55 and a smear of jointing paste.
 
use ptfe, obv make sure it is wrapped the correct way, give it a good tighten but dont go mad,also put boss white on the ptfe, and if this does not work check the threads on the valve, they may be off if it was not fitted inline and then tightened
